How much does it cost to go to Gracelands?

TOUR PRICE
Adult 11 and up $79.75
Youth 5-10 $45.50
Children 4 and Under** FREE

How long will a tour of Graceland take?

A tour of the mansion takes about one to one and a half hours. The Elvis Experience tour, which includes the mansion, car museum and several other exhibits, takes anywhere from two and a half to three and a half hours.

How to get cheap tickets to Graceland?

Become a Graceland Insider This incredible program rewards fans for their devotion with discounts on everything Elvis. A $21.99 membership gets you a personalized membership card, $3 off Graceland [Graceland is a mansion on a 13.8-acre (5.6-hectare) estate in Memphis, Tennessee, United States, which was once owned by the rock and roll singer Elvis Presley. His daughter, Lisa Marie Presley, inherited Graceland after his death in 1977, until her own death in 2023] parking and 10% off everything from rooms at the Heartbreak Hotel to Graceland tour tickets.

What is so special about Graceland?

Graceland welcomes over 500,000 visitors each year, is one of the five most visited home tours in the United States, and is the most famous home in America after The White House. In 1991, Graceland was placed on the National Register of Historic Places. In 2006, it was designated a National Historic Landmark.

How much to tour graceland, Take a look inside the Presley Motors Automobile Museum. See his Pink Cadillac, a 1975 Dino Ferrari, a 1973 Stutz Blackhawk and lots more. In the Elvis: The Entertainer Career Museum, see an amazing collection of gold and platinum records, stage costumes (including his famous jumpsuits), plus memorabilia from his movies.

This ticket also includes Elvis Airplanes – the chance to climb aboard his customized jet. See its lavish rooms (including a bedroom), gold-plated seat belts, suede chairs, and leather-covered tables. He really knew how to travel in style!
